सर्वे लोकाः समाच्छन्ना यया योगेन रात्रिषु । कालस्य तिस्रो भार्याश्च संध्या रात्रिर्दिनानि च
By her power, all worlds are covered in the nights through yoga; time has three wives: twilight, night, and day.
याभिर्विना विधाता च संख्यां कर्तुं न शक्यते । क्षुत्पिपासे लोभभार्ये धन्ये मान्ये च पूजिते
Without them, even the Creator is unable to reckon the count; hunger and thirst are the wives of prosperity, honor, and worship.
याभ्यां व्याप्तं जगत्सर्वं नित्यं चिन्तातुरं भवेत् । प्रभा च दाहिका चैव द्वे भार्ये तेजसस्तथा
By these two, the whole world is pervaded and always afflicted by anxiety; radiance and burning are the two wives of energy.
याभ्यां विना जगत्स्रष्टा विधातुं च न हीश्वरः । कालकन्ये मृत्युजरे प्रज्वारस्य प्रियाप्रिये
Without these, the creator of the world is not able to bring forth creation; the daughters of Time—Death and Old Age—are the beloved and unlovely of fever.
याभ्यां जगत्समुच्छिन्नं विधात्रा निर्मितं विधौ । निद्राकन्या च तन्द्रा सा प्रीतिरन्या सुखप्रिये
By these two, the world is destroyed, and by the Creator, they are established in creation; sleep is the daughter, and drowsiness, while delight is another, dear to happiness.
याभ्यां व्याप्तं जगत्सर्वं विधिपुत्र विधेर्विधौ । वैराग्यस्य च द्वे भार्ये श्रद्धा भक्तिश्च पूजिते
By these two, the whole world is pervaded, O son of the Creator, in the act of creation; dispassion has two wives: faith and devotion, both honored.
याभ्यां शश्वज्जगत्सर्वं यज्जीवन्मुक्तिमन्मुने । अदितिर्देवमाता च सुरभी च गवां प्रसूः
By these two, the entire world, which is ever liberated while living, exists, O sage; Aditi is the mother of the gods, and Surabhi is the mother of cows.
दितिश्च दैत्यजननी कद्रूश्च विनता दनुः । उपयुक्ताः सृष्टिविधावेतास्तु कीर्तिताः कलाः
Diti is the mother of the Daityas, Kadrū and Vinatā and Danu; these, employed in the act of creation, are the powers that have been described.
कला अन्याः सन्ति बह्व्यस्तासु काश्चिन्निबोध मे । रोहिणी चन्द्रपत्नी च संज्ञा सूर्यस्य कामिनी
There are many other powers; among them, listen to some from me: Rohiṇī is the wife of the Moon, Saṃjñā is the beloved of the Sun.
शतरूपा मनोर्भार्या शचीन्द्रस्य च गेहिनी । तारा बृहस्पतेर्भार्या वसिष्ठस्याप्यरुन्धती
Śatarūpā is the wife of Manu, Śacī is the spouse of Indra; Tārā is the wife of Bṛhaspati, and Arundhatī is the wife of Vasiṣṭha.
अहल्या गौतमस्त्री साप्यनसूयात्रिकामिनी । देवहूतिः कर्दमस्य प्रसूतिर्दक्षकामिनी
Ahalyā is the wife of Gautama, Anasūyā is the beloved of Atri; Devahūti is the wife of Kardama, Prasūti is the beloved of Dakṣa.
पितॄणां मानसी कन्या मेनका साम्बिकाप्रसूः । लोपामुद्रा तथा कुन्ती कुबेरकामिनी तथा
The mind-born daughter of the ancestors is Menakā, the offspring of Ambikā; Lopāmudrā, Kuntī, and also the beloved of Kubera.
वरुणानी प्रसिद्धा च बलेर्विन्ध्यावलिस्तथा । कान्ता च दमयन्ती च यशोदा देवकी तथा
Varuṇānī is renowned, as is Vindhyāvalī, the wife of Bali; also the beloved Damayantī, Yaśodā, and Devakī.
गान्धारी द्रौपदी शैव्या सा च सत्यवती प्रिया । वृषभानुप्रिया साध्वी राधामाता कुलोद्वहा
Gāndhārī, Draupadī, Śaivyā, and the dear Satyavatī; the virtuous Vṛṣabhānu's beloved, Rādhā's mother, the upholder of her lineage.
मन्दोदरी च कौसल्या सुभद्रा कौरवी तथा । रेवती सत्यभामा च कालिन्दी लक्ष्मणा तथा
Mandodarī, Kausalyā, Subhadrā, and the Kaurava princess; Revatī, Satyabhāmā, Kālindī, and Lakṣmaṇā as well.
जाम्बवती नाग्नजितिर्मित्रविन्दा तथापरा । लक्ष्मणा रुक्मिणी सीता स्वयं लक्ष्मीः प्रकीर्तिता
Jāmbavatī, Nāgnajitī, Mitravindā, and another; Lakṣmaṇā, Rukmiṇī, Sītā—who herself is called Lakṣmī.
काली योजनगन्धा च व्यासमाता महासती । बाणपुत्री तथोषा च चित्रलेखा च तत्सखी
Kālī, Yojanagandhā, Vyāsa's mother, the great and virtuous one; Bāṇa's daughter Uṣā, and her friend Citralekhā.
प्रभावती भानुमती तथा मायावती सती । रेणुका च भृगोर्माता राममाता च रोहिणी
Prabhāvatī, Bhānumatī, and the faithful Māyāvatī; Reṇukā, mother of Bhṛgu, and Rohiṇī, mother of Rāma.
एकनन्दा च दुर्गा सा श्रीकृष्णभगिनी सती । बह्व्यः सत्यः कलाश्चैव प्रकृतेरेव भारते
Ekanandā, Durgā, and the virtuous sister of Śrī Kṛṣṇa; many true and partial manifestations as well, all from Prakṛti in Bhārata.
या याश्च ग्रामदेव्यः स्युस्ताः सर्वाः प्रकृतेः कलाः । कलांशांशसमुद्भूताः प्रतिविश्वेषु योषितः
And all the village goddesses—these are all aspects of Prakṛti; women in every world arise from portions and sub-portions of her.
योषितामवमानेन प्रकृतेश्च पराभवः । ब्राह्मणी पूजिता येन पतिपुत्रवती सती
By disrespecting women, there is defeat of Prakṛti; the Brāhmaṇī who is honored becomes a chaste wife with husband and sons.
प्रकृतिः पूजिता तेन वस्त्रालङ्कारचन्दनैः । कुमारी चाष्टवर्षीया वस्त्रालङ्कारचन्दनैः
Prakṛti is worshipped by him with garments, ornaments, and sandal paste; and so is the maiden of eight years, with garments, ornaments, and sandal paste.
पूजिता येन विप्रस्य प्रकृतिस्तेन पूजिता । सर्वाः प्रकृतिसम्भूता उत्तमाधममध्यमाः
Whoever worships her in the form of a maiden thus worships Prakṛti; all women, whether superior, inferior, or middling, are born from Prakṛti.
सत्त्वांशाश्चोत्तमा ज्ञेयाः सुशीलाश्च पतिव्रताः । मध्यमा रजसश्चांशास्ताश्च भोग्याः प्रकीर्तिताः
Those of the highest quality are to be known as virtuous and devoted to their husbands; the middling, born of rajas, are said to be for enjoyment.
सुखसम्भोगवश्याश्च स्वकार्ये तत्पराः सदा । अधमास्तमसश्चांशा अज्ञातकुलसम्भवाः
They are always eager for pleasure and devoted to their own affairs; the lowest, born of tamas, are of unknown lineage.
दुर्मुखाः कुलहा धूर्ताः स्वतन्त्राः कलहप्रियाः । पृथिव्यां कुलटा याश्च स्वर्गे चाप्सरसां गणाः
They are ill-spoken, destroyers of families, deceitful, independent, and fond of quarrels; on earth they are called wanton women, and in heaven, the groups of apsarases.
प्रकृतेस्तमसश्चांशाः पुंश्चल्यः परिकीर्तिताः । एवं निगदितं सर्वं प्रकृते रूपवर्णनम्
These are said to be the women arising from the portion of tamas in Prakṛti; thus the forms and types of Prakṛti have all been described.
ताः सर्वाः पूजिताः पृथ्व्यां पुण्यक्षेत्रे च भारते । पूजिता सुरथेनादौ दुर्गा दुर्गार्तिनाशिनी
All these are worshipped on earth, especially in the sacred land of Bhārata; first worshipped by Suratha, Durgā, the remover of distress.
ततः श्रीरामचन्द्रेण रावणस्य वधार्थिना । तत्पश्चाज्जगतां माता त्रिषु लोकेषु पूजिता
Then by Śrī Rāma Candra, who sought the destruction of Rāvaṇa; thereafter, the Mother of the worlds was worshipped in the three realms.
जाताऽऽदौ दक्षकन्या या निहत्य दैत्यदानवान् । ततो देहं परित्यज्य यज्ञे भर्तुश्च निन्दया
At first, she was born as Dakṣa's daughter, who slew the daityas and dānavas; then, abandoning her body in the sacrifice due to her husband's insult.
